Dental Procedures Used in Cosmetic Dentistry

Cosmetic dentistry generally refers to any type of dental procedure which improves the look of the mouth, gums or bite. It mainly focuses on aesthetic improvement in the teeth shape, color, positioning, color and overall appearance. It aims at improving the look of the smile and the way people perceive the person who is smiling.
